Job description
- Arrives at school promptly and stays until such time as necessary responsibilities are completed
- Develops a warm rapport with students and a positive, secure, neat and attractive classroom environment; trains students in habits and routines which are part of the FCS philosophy; maintains excellent student conduct and attention
- Becomes very familiar with yearly curriculum objectives and participates actively in curriculum writing and revising
- Develops professionally by exploring and being willing to implement new instructional techniques and curriculum
- Uses Curriculum Trak software to prepare lesson plans to ensure that the objectives of the curriculum are being met
- Keeps attendance records, records grades according to department standards, and records of other monies from special projects if applicable
- Fosters a spirit of patriotism and respect by conducting daily pledges
- Places God's Word in a central position in daily instruction, integrating its principles throughout the day
- Prays regularly for each child and presents the Gospel message and other biblical instruction with sensitivity and love; faithfully follows the philosophy and Bible guidelines of the school
- Individualizes instruction and student assessment to meet the needs of both weaker and stronger students in cooperation with Resource Center and fellow teachers
- Learns and applies educationally relevant technology skills for teaching, learning, and administrative tasks with support from the FCS technology department
- Enriches basic curriculum with field trips, creative assignments, and library resources
- Checks student work and sends it home on a regular basis
- Maintains close, cooperative relationship with parents, communicating frequently with parents and responding to parent emails within 24 hours
- Attends weekly faculty meetings, Prayer 'N' Share at least one time weekly, and evening activities of the school as directed; participates in professional development
- Is prompt and faithful with supervision duty on a regularly scheduled basis
- Dresses professionally and modestly, following the Staff Dress Code
- Seeks an awareness of the total school vision and serves willingly in special areas which enhance the overall effectiveness of the ministry
Requirements
The Classroom Teacher should have the following qualifications:
- Committed Christian with a close personal walk with the Lord and the Christian character qualities to serve as a role model for young people
- Regular in attendance at an evangelical Protestant church
- Commitment to a Biblical lifestyle, not promoting or engaging in premarital, extramarital, transgender, or homosexual behavior
- If married, a solid commitment based on Mark 10:9 and positive marital relationship
- Strong commitment to Christian education
- Bachelor's or graduate degree in related field, including education courses
- Committed to keeping ACSI or state certification current according to FCS guidelines
- Ability to maintain an orderly learning atmosphere
- Enthusiastic, sensitive, loving rapport with students, openness with parents and staff
- Strong grasp of subject matter and keen ability to communicate concepts to students with a variety of learning styles, stimulate higher level thinking, and involve students in lessons
- Well organized, diligent, creative
- Ability to carry out physical requirements related to the job and building environment, such as (but not limited to) climbing stairs, riding the bus, supervising students both out-of-doors and indoors
- Teachable, servant spirit
